How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Bonneville County?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Bonneville County Studio Apartments | $1,231 | $950 | $1,314 |
| Bonneville County 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,298 | $302 | $1,650 |
| Bonneville County 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,596 | $744 | $2,556 |
| Bonneville County 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,958 | $1,060 | $6,120 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Bonneville County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Bonneville County with 2 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 2 Bedroom in Bonneville County is at Black Feather Apartments listed at $1,194.
How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Bonneville County Apartment?
The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Bonneville County is $1,596.
What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Bonneville County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Bonneville County is a 1,366 square feet unit starting from $1,789 at Southbridge Townhomes.
What is the average size for Bonneville County 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Bonneville County is currently 1,000 sq ft.
